BlockBeats News, June 6th, Peter Navarro, the trade advisor to the U.S. President, stated that President Trump's public feud with Musk is insignificant, calling Musk merely "a special government employee who will leave when his term is up."
Navarro said, "People come and go in the White House." Navarro implied that Musk's criticism of Trump's domestic policy agenda was unfounded and directly pushed back on external concerns about the plan. Navarro also criticized Musk's long-standing opposition to tariffs, which are at the core of Trump's trade policy.
"Musk doesn't like tariffs, that's all," he said, noting that Musk has been "clear" about this since Trump's first term. Navarro said, "We can disagree on this issue, but I just want to say that in my first term, everyone who said tariffs would lead to economic downturn and inflation was clearly mistaken." (Golden Ten)
